Robert I. Townsend III is a partner in Cravath’s Corporate Department and serves as Co-Chair of the Global Mergers and Acquisitions Practice. His practice focuses primarily on all types of M&A transactions, corporate governance matters and activist defense.

Career

Harvard Law School (JD, magna cum laude, 1990; Executive Editor, 'Law Review'); Harvard College (AB, magna cum laude, 1987)

Individual Editorial

Robert Townsend serves as co-head of Cravath's global M&A practice and advises on major transactions across a broad spectrum of industries. He is well reputed for his sophisticated practice advising top public companies.
